Pure Pleasure : A Guide to the 20th Century's Most Enjoyable Books
Faber & Faber
Pure Pleasure gives us fifty of the most enjoyable books of the twentieth century, chosen on a single principle - the pleasure they inspire. Pure Pleasure is an idiosyncratic antidote to the 'definitive' lists of twentieth-century classics. John Carey, one of Britain's most respected literary critics, has unearthed some overlooked gems which show the century's great authors in a new light. The result is a wonderful and witty guide for anyone looking for new recommendations or for a discussion of books they already know and love.
